Beat: Ausklappbares Menu bestehend aus Button

Beitrag lesen

Ich versuche ein Menu zu erstellen mit selbst gestalteten Button.
Einer der Button soll sich beim Roll-Over ausklappen, um ein Submenu aus Button anzuzeigen.
Würde sagen, dass ich dazu eine Liste in einer Liste erstellen muss... aber finde einfach keinen Weg über CSS, so dass es klappt...
Wie muss ich die IDs/Klassen für <ul> / <li> / <a> definieren, so dass es funktioniert? (die Button selbst haben eine Größe von 120px x 30 px)

...hier meine allgemeine Struktur dafür in HTML:

<div>
  <ul>
    <li> <a href="#" alt=""></a> </li>
    <li> <a href="#" alt=""></a> </li>
    <ul>
      <li> <a href="#" alt=""></a> </li>
      <li> <a href="#" alt=""></a> </li>
    </ul>
    <li> <a href="#" alt=""></a> </li>
    <li> <a href="#" alt=""></a> </li>
  </ul>
</div>

Dein HTML ist fehlerhaft.
Ein <ul> Element darf nur <li> Elemente als Children haben.
a Elemente kennen kein alt Attribut.

<ul class="navigation">  
  <li> <a href="#">1</a> </li>  
  <li> label  
    <ul class="subnavigation">  
       <li> <a href="#">2a</a> </li>  
       <li> <a href="#">2b</a> </li>  
    </ul>  
  </li>  
  <li> <a href="#">3</a> </li>  
</ul>  

mfg Beat

--
><o(((°>           ><o(((°>
   <°)))o><                     ><o(((°>o
Der Valigator leibt diese Fische